Manhattan no longer prosecuting sex-workers; where does S.I. stand? Updated Apr 22, 2021; Posted Apr 22, 2021 Manhattan District Attorney Cyrus Vance Jr. this week said his office no longer will prosecute cases against sex-workers, while prosecuting pimps, traffickers and people who pay for sex will continue.(Getty Images)Getty Images Facebook Share STATEN ISLAND, N.Y. The Manhattan District Attorney’s Office will no longer prosecute cases against sex workers, while criminal cases against sex traffickers, pimps and those who pay for the service will continue. The shift in policy is part of a growing movement across the U.S. to reform the way sex-for-money is policed.

‘I will shoot you in the face.’ Ex-con busted on armed robbery charge Updated 10:49 AM; Today 10:49 AM Paris Williams threatened to shoot a worker in the Port Richmond store before stealing cash on March 24, 2021, prosecutors allege. Facebook Share STATEN ISLAND, N.Y. –- An ex-convict from Port Richmond who’s already served two prison stints for robbery could soon make it three. Paris Williams, 31, was busted on Thursday in connection with an alleged armed stickup in his community on March 24, said police. The events unfolded around 6:30 p.m. inside a Metro by T-Mobile store at 234 Port Richmond Ave., said a criminal complaint.

Should sex work be a crime? As debate over decriminalizing heats up, a look at what it means on S.I. Updated Mar 07, 2021; Posted Mar 07, 2021 Websites and brothels promoting escorts and erotic massages aren t difficult to find on Staten Island, while New York lawmakers debate whether to decriminalize the profession for workers and clients. Facebook Share STATEN ISLAND, N.Y. Sex-for-sale on Staten Island is just a few clicks away. There are websites advertising scores of girls for either “incall” or “outcall” appointments on our borough. There are erotic massage parlors and brothels catalogued in online directories. And for wealthier clients, there are escorts advertising by word of mouth and communicating via personal email.

Kindness Team working to make a difference at I.S. 75 | In Class column Updated Mar 08, 2021; Posted Mar 07, 2021 Briana Delbuono, left, and Stephanie Theodorou are teachers at Paulo Intermediate School, Huguenot. They are part of the Kindness Team at the school. (Courtesy/Briana Delbuono) Facebook Share STATEN ISLAND, N.Y. Teachers at Paulo Intermediate School (I.S. 75) in Huguenot are working to instill kindness among their school community, as well as bring the important topics of diversity and equity into the school’s curriculum. Teachers Briana Delbuono and Stephanie Theodorou, seen in the photo above, are part of the school’s Kindness Team. Other members include: Principal Kenneth Zapata, Assistant Principal Danielle Martinson, literacy coach Michael Trimble, eighth-grade guidance counselor Lauren Castellan, and teachers Ryan Murphy, Meredith Feigel, and Courtney Saccomanno.
